A man died on Universal’s Stardust Racers in September, sparking safety concerns amid reports of multiple injuries since the ride opened.
A 32-year-old man died on September 17 riding the Stardust Racers roller coaster at Universal’s Epic Universe in Orlando, prompting safety concerns.
His attorney, Ben Crump, said multiple riders, including one who lost consciousness and suffered neck and spine injuries, have reported similar incidents since the ride opened in May.
Crump questioned Universal’s response to prior warnings and highlighted the park’s exemption from state safety inspections, calling for greater oversight.
The Florida Department of Agriculture and Consumer Services reported three injury incidents at the park since opening, including cases involving preexisting conditions.
Universal and state investigators found no mechanical failure, but Crump argues warning signs were ignored and victims may have been unfairly blamed.
The family seeks answers, emphasizing their son’s spinal disability did not contribute to the incident.
